CO_2低压溶剂羧化法合成2,6-二羟基苯甲酸工艺研究  被引量:1

Study on preparation of 2,6-dihydroxybenzoic acid by solvent carboxylation with CO_2 under low pressure

摘  要:研究了间苯二酚低压溶剂羧化法合成2,6-二羟基苯甲酸。适宜的反应条件为:反应压力0.4MPa~0.5MPa反应温度140℃,反应时间6h^7h,n(间苯二酚)/n(氢氧化钾)=1/2.05,溶剂为甲苯。在适宜的条件下,产物经洗涤、酸化、脱色和重结晶等后处理工序,产品收率达70%,纯度大于99%(HPLC)。Preparation of 2,6-dihydoxybenzoic acid by direct carboxylation of resorcinol with CO2 in solvent under low pressure was studied. The optimum reaction parameters were determined as follows: reaction pressure of 0.4-0.5MPa, reaction temperature of 140℃, reaction time of 6-7 hours, molar ratio of resorcinol to potassium hydroxide of 1:2.05 and toluene as solvent. Under the optimized conditions, after washing, acidification, decolorization and reerystallization, the yield of 2,6-dihydroxybenzoic acid could be up to 70% with the purity of more than 99 % (HPLC).
